Transaction 1fab628aa07a4519542aa4030167e7e4d2416d4269f780477fad654b5eba8312
1 Input
1 Output
-
1fab628aa07a4519542aa4030167e7e4d2416d4269f780477fad654b5eba8312:0
- value
- 423796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c34de3ec3d8ea435da7345075e2c2434b203777d OP_EQUAL
- address
- 3KVgzs8vCv9JQKEdx3D7iNdE8DifqwvXGS